Choosing a Lightweight Folding Wheelchair

A lightweight folding wheelchair is a wonderful option for those with restricted mobility. It can be easily stored in the trunk of a car or other transport vehicles. It also has a battery that is airline approved, ensuring smooth travel.

It's important to note that power wheelchairs require regular maintenance. Battery life is affected by a number of factors, including usage patterns and the type of charger.

There are many types of power wheelchairs on the market, ranging from traditional batteries that are not removable to lighter Lithium-ion models. It is essential to select the right kind of battery for your needs and lifestyle since it will determine how long you will be able to use the chair before having to be charged. If you're on a tight budget, you might want to consider an electric wheelchair with a lithium-ion battery that can last for up to 14 hours.

Lightweight electric wheelchairs can be extremely convenient and are perfect for traveling. They can be folded up and transported in planes, cars and buses. They are also ideal for day trips since they can go up to 3 or 4 miles per hour.

Long battery life

The battery is the core of any power wheelchair and plays a crucial part in the longevity of the wheelchair. Picking a model with an extended battery life will help you avoid spending a lot of time at the charging station. The battery's lifespan is based on a variety of factors, including how frequently you use the wheelchair as well as the terrain it is used in. It is also essential to clean your chair regularly and keep the batteries in good working order. Regular professional checks can help you detect issues early and prevent worsening.

When selecting a light power wheelchair, you should take into consideration the maximum speed and weight capacity. Make sure that it is folded and fit in your vehicle, trunk or car. Also, ensure that it complies with airline standards for air travel. Lastly, you should look for a wheelchair with a warranty that gives you an adequate amount of protection.
